Motivation is an Easter Study Camp specifically designed to meet the needs of Year 11 to 13 students by offering three elements: spiritual input, fantastic water sports and academic help.
We provide students with a structured study environment, invigorating outdoor activities and inspiring Christian worship and Bible teaching. The day is structured to give around four to five hours of study time in three slots – two in the morning and one in the evening. Drinks and snack breaks are provided throughout! Supporting these sessions are a team of graduates and qualified teachers, who can provide one-to-one tuition.
The afternoons at Motivation are for recreational Sailing and Windsurfing on Lake Windermere under the watchful eye of RYA-trained staff. We use the same fantastic site that Lakeland Challenge and Sail and Surf camps use in the summer which caters for all abilities on the water. Each day we meet together at various times for worship and Bible study to motivate us to travel further in our Christian faith.
The top-class accommodation, catering, and water sports facilities provided at the site, all combine to make sure that you will have a refreshing holiday as well as achieve effective study.
